In this demonstration, we roll a ball bearing down ramp affixed to our rotary table and is filmed by a camera that is also attached to the table. Without rotation, the ball travels in a straight line. However, when we rotate the table in the counterclockwise (right-handed) direction, the ball deflects off to its right. When we increase the rate of rotation, the ball deflects off to its right to a greater degree.
